What is a health insurance policy?

It's a contract between you and an insurance company that helps cover your medical expenses, including medicines, surgeries, consultations, room rent, and ambulance charges. It ensures you receive necessary medical care without worrying about the burden of unexpected bills.

8 key benefits of Health Insurance

1. Protection from rising medical bills: Medical inflation in India will increase to 11% in 2024 from 9.6% in 2023. During such a time, having health insurance can be invaluable to safeguard you and your family from the rising medical costs.

2. Hassle-free cashless treatment: Today most health policies offer cashless coverage. This brings in peace of mind during emergencies.

3. Comprehensive hospitalisation coverage: With health insurance, you can be covered for hospitalisation expenses, whether it's for an accident or illness. 

4. Pre-and post-hospitalization support: Many treatments require pre and post hospitalisation that can cause financial burden on you. But the correct health insurance policy covers all these essential medical needs, easing your recovery journey.

5. Regular wellness check-ups: Not just for a treatment, your health insurance can help you stay ahead of health issues with annual wellness check-ups. This promotes proactive health management.

6. Tax Savings: Under Section 80D, there are specific tax benefits of health insurance applicable to some conditions. Thus health insurance reduces your tax burden while investing in your health and financial well-being.

7. No-claim bonus: Want to get rewarded for staying healthy? Your health insurance might just give you that. Policies offer bonus benefits for not making claims during the policy period, allowing you to increase your coverage without paying extra.

8. Rider protection: It offers additional benefits alongside your health insurance policy, making it even more valuable. For instance, consider the critical illness rider. This benefit offers coverage against specific life-threatening diseases by paying a lump sum amount, which can be used to cover these high expenses, over and above the coverage from your health insurance.

It's like having an extra safety net for your health.

4 common misconceptions about health insurance

Still debating whether to get health insurance? Here are some common myths to help you make a faster decision:

  • You don't need insurance if you're young & fit

 False. Health issues can arise at any age, making insurance essential. Plus premiums are lower if you start early and helps accrue a no-claim bonus as well

  • Corporate insurance is enough

Nope. Personal health insurance ensures continuous coverage, especially when in-between jobs. Also, corporate coverage may not be sufficient.

  • Hospitalisation is always necessary for claims

No. Many plans cover day care procedures without hospital stays.

  • Pregnancy isn't covered

Some policies cover pregnancy, but it's essential to review details for coverage.

Before purchasing health insurance, consider these key points:

  1. Verify your insurer's credentials 

  2. Calculate the coverage you need 

  3. Understand the co-payment clause

  4. Check room restrictions for hospitalisation

  5. Be aware of disease-specific limitations of your policy

  6. Ensure if it offers the coverage for pre and post-hospitalisation care

  7. Look for shorter waiting periods

  8. Inquire about no-claim bonuses
